## Point locations

| Point | Name | Meridian | Location |
|---|---|---|---|
| ST24 | Slippery Flesh Gate | Stomach Meridian | 1 thumb width above the umbilicus 2 thumb widths lateral to the CV09. |
| ST26 | Outer Mound | Stomach Meridian | 1 thumb width below umbilicus 2 thumb widths lateral to the CV07. |
| CV04 | Original Qi Gate | Conception Vessel | On the anterior midline 3 thumb widths below umbilicus. |
| CV06 | Sea Of Qi | Conception Vessel | On the anterior midline 1.5 thumb widths below umbilicus. |
| CV10 | Lower Stomach | Conception Vessel | On the anterior midline 2 thumb widths above the umbilicus. |
| CV12 | Stomach Centre | Conception Vessel | On the anterior midline 4 thumb widths above the umbilicus. |
